Unlink Gmail from Apple ID

My Apple ID has a gmail address as it's primary email address and my iCloud as the alternate address (sticktly it's a .me address).


I now no longer want my iCloud address to be accosiated with that Gmail address, rather I just want the iCloud as a stand alone Apple ID.


Is this possible and if so, how do I do it?

You cannot make your @icloud.com or @me.com the login address to replace a non-Apple address. You can change the GMail address to something else as long as it's not an Apple address. If you are going to do this you need to follow the procedure here:


Firstly, if you have 'Find My iPhone/iPad/iMac' enabled on any of your devices, turn it off.


Create a new email address, for example at Yahoo or Gmail, or anywhere convenient (or you can use an existing address as long as it has never been associated with an Apple ID).


Go to http://appleid.apple.com and click 'Manage your Apple ID'. Sign in with the current ID.


Where it says 'Apple ID and primary email address' and gives your current ID email address, click 'edit'.


Enter your new address and click 'Save changes'.


Now you will need to go to each of your devices and sign out in System Preferences (or Settings)>iCloud - 'Sign out' on a Mac, 'Delete this account' on an iOS device (this will not delete the account from the server).


Then sign back in with your new ID. Your iCloud data will disappear from your devices when you sign out, but reappear when you sign back in.


I re-iterate: before you start, turn off 'Find My Mac' (or whatever) or you will need the services of Support.
